> I'm still searching for a solution for this. I'll try to explain where I'm at
> step by step, to grant more insight on the situation.
>
> Ubuntu 11.04
> Msql 5.1
> php 5.3
> apache2.2
>
> 1. Install citrus 2.4
> 2. edit config.inc.php (I edited everything that the manual instructed me to,
> these are the edits that I'm not sure if I did correctly)
>
> $url_prefix = "http://localhost/citrusdb";;;
> $ssl_url_prefix = "https://localhost/citrusdb";;;
> and my path is:
> $path_to_citrus = '/var/www/citrusdb/';
>
> 3.open browser (firefox) enter http://localhost/citrusdb
>
> I see the citrusdb log in screen and logo
>
> 4.  and finally, enter user/password click login
>
> receive this message on https://localhost/citrusdb/index.php
>
> Unable to connect
>
>          Firefox can't establish a connection to the server at localhost.
>
>  The site could be temporarily unavailable or too busy. Try again in a few
>    moments.
>  If you are unable to load any pages, check your computer's network
>    connection.
>  If your computer or network is protected by a firewall or proxy, make sure
>    that Firefox is permitted to access the Web.
>
> please help.
